Figure 3. LD plots in which the upper triangular matrix represents the P values calculated using Fisher's Exact test; the lower triangular matrix represents r 2, the coefficient of determination between allelic states at pairs of sites.
Colored shading in the LD plot indicates statistical significance in linkage (P<0.01) and strength of associations (0.8<r 2<1) among sites. In the reference population from the United States, there are six and five distinct LD blocks (outlined squares) in A. flavus L and A. parasiticus, respectively, based on P and r2. Aspergillus parasiticus was not found in India and Benin; A. flavus S and A. minisclerotigenes were not found in India and the United States and infrequently sampled in Argentina such that recombination could not be determined.
